POOL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

609 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pool Corp (POOL)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$8.59B — up 14% from $7.51B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 147 funds opened new POOL positions and 129 closed out — a net gain of 18 holders — while 194 added to existing stakes and 202 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$347M. The largest seller was Invesco, cutting an estimated $145M.
